Type
ORACLE
Validation date
2025-09-30 03:15:30 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(41 B)

{
  "uco": {
    "eur": 1.9912e-4,
    "usd": 2.3339e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00010F2788A48C7E535244B0C327867C4411BDF6C334F53681B9347CEC0CD991634B

Previous signature

0AD25B9DC2C9D3495E9686727C95C76068002C465787B4F27774EC7D544FEDCFB449826CE375AF70CFE3741758192CE1383447131871689C7E975061F7B83C0E

Origin signature

3046022100937476DDE35441DF07BE27C55107FBC29FB8A6E99031BCEB86EDEE2AD555C9E2022100A03F308ECABF0B00DEA4F7813DC5CBF9397A70A642F81793DA50DEB7AF8C4DFF

Proof of work

0102045AAF36BF9EA9E11F1F79834294FB1098C173F2333B562762711E02C63EA9F459909F714C243F04922D1EBE15510E1B4667550E9C980F7742295E002584B0482B

Proof of integrity

002528FCFF10C7BD18D24C1335794695F8372E8179A77FE314AA4AFFA75DA28124

Coordinator signature

E1FC56FC2686C7057F7D700DD71FF67EB4721A152B64DDD801444D5647225CF1179A8ED85F3F4566D5B3289FBFAA4375099E82FA0DE92543A7E0AFE135BBC504

Validator #1 public key

00018A13A9C85FE66CE097EE273C6F1E612289BFB0B630C34AF60957E8DE880633E2

Validator #1 signature

F6B8B72E6654BF930CC70AAC1AD015D05FDB97CC54B2E43D34D6A362E279B0229349C1B0965594EA0E9C3ED21914FBF2FF01DFAEF0EFF9EA77D74F6865C98B0E

Validator #2 public key

0001AA2CB2D202420DADFCF965225B9F0493D1F148F07850C02BD27BD58234E9E58D

Validator #2 signature

516545551F43EBB30BD807F097684317C99D34A52E3A8C75F69E0BB3B42370ABF2D88257AD8BF07F28B68F83CDC08F0A45395B190AE85FD487E2264232484E0C